首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

UICollectionViewLayout和NavigationBar -错误的y位置

UICollectionViewLayout是iOS开发中的一个类,用于定义UICollectionView的布局方式。它是UICollectionView的子类,负责计算和管理UICollectionView中每个单元格的位置和大小。

UICollectionViewLayout可以通过自定义来实现不同的布局效果,例如网格布局、瀑布流布局、环形布局等。开发者可以根据需求自定义UICollectionViewLayout的子类,并重写其中的方法来实现特定的布局效果。

优势:

  1. 灵活性:UICollectionViewLayout提供了灵活的布局方式,可以根据需求自定义各种不同的布局效果,满足不同场景的需求。
  2. 可扩展性:通过继承UICollectionViewLayout,开发者可以自定义布局方式,实现更多样化的界面效果。
  3. 性能优化:UICollectionViewLayout通过计算和管理单元格的位置和大小,可以提高界面的渲染性能。

应用场景:

  1. 图片浏览器:可以使用UICollectionViewLayout实现瀑布流布局,展示不同大小的图片。
  2. 商品展示:可以使用UICollectionViewLayout实现网格布局,展示商品列表。
  3. 相册应用:可以使用UICollectionViewLayout实现环形布局,展示相册中的照片。

推荐的腾讯云相关产品: 腾讯云提供了丰富的云计算产品,其中与移动开发相关的产品包括:

  1. 腾讯移动推送:提供消息推送服务,帮助开发者实现消息推送功能。产品介绍链接:https://cloud.tencent.com/product/tpns
  2. 腾讯移动分析:提供移动应用数据分析服务,帮助开发者了解用户行为和应用性能。产品介绍链接:https://cloud.tencent.com/product/ma

以上是对UICollectionViewLayout的概念、分类、优势、应用场景以及推荐的腾讯云相关产品的介绍。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

7分22秒

02-Jenkins在开发中所处的位置和作用

30分53秒

32. 尚硅谷_佟刚_Struts2_类型转换错误消息的显示和定制

17分7秒

7.根据播放的位置计算出歌词下标索引&高亮时间和时间戳.avi

29秒

SOLIDWORKS 2023新功能亮点揭秘:修复遗漏的配合参考

6分52秒

Python 人工智能 数据分析库 53 3D图形和矩阵 2 3d解释的错误 学习猿地

9分56秒

055.error的包装和拆解

11分2秒

1.13.同x不同y和同y不同x,求私钥

6分9秒

054.go创建error的四种方式

6分21秒

腾讯位置 - 逆地址解析

7分33秒

058.error的链式输出

20秒

LabVIEW颜色检测来检查汽车保险丝安装情况

4分48秒

1.11.椭圆曲线方程的离散点

领券